What's the best time of year to travel to Kenai with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ping tabs on the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 54°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 23°F. The snowiest months in Kenai are December, November, February, and March,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of snowf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Kenai?
Known for its riverfront, Kenai has lots to offer visitors including its churches and mountains. See the local sights and visit Kenai Visitors and Cultural Center and Kenai Beach. While you're there, make sure you don't miss North Peninsula Recreation Area and Captain Cook State Recreation Area.
